The cherry blossoms are out and that means the popular Dulwich Festival is fast approaching!


This year?s festival will host a tremendous calendar of art, music and cultural inspiration all squeezed into ten exhilarating days from 6th-15th May. In it's 23rd year, the festival boasts a fantastic programme of music concerts, literary and theatre events, walks and fairs, as well as the Artists' Open House weekends and mouth-watering Food Trail.
